The size of Greensborough is approximately 10.2 square kilometres. It has 41 parks covering nearly 12.1% of total area. The population of Greensborough in 2011 was 20,552 people. By 2016 the population was 20,803 showing a population growth of 1.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Greensborough is 40-49 years. Households in Greensborough are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Greensborough work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 81.6% of the homes in Greensborough were owner-occupied compared with 80.4% in 2016.
